Original Description
Viviano Codazzi’s A Capriccio of Roman Ruins with Peasants Amongst Ruins by the Equestrian Statue of Marcus Aurelius is a breathtaking 17th-century masterpiece that masterfully blends architectural precision with poetic imagination. Set against the grandeur of crumbling Roman arches and columns, the painting juxtaposes the solemnity of classical ruins with the lively presence of peasants going about their daily lives. The majestic equestrian statue of Marcus Aurelius, a symbol of imperial power, stands as a silent witness to the passage of time. Codazzi, a leading figure in the veduta ideata (idealized view) tradition, combines rigorous perspective and meticulous detail with fantastical elements, creating a nostalgic yet vibrant scene. This work exemplifies the Baroque fascination with antiquity’s grandeur and decay, positioning Codazzi as a key bridge between architectural realism and capriccio’s whimsy in art history. Its historical and artistic significance lies in its evocative portrayal of Rome’s eternal allure.
